Nov. 9, 2001 The Washburn Lady Blues fell 3-0 (30-12, 30-28, 30-27) to Missouri Western in St. Joseph, Mo. Friday night. The Lady Blues came out cold, hitting -.120 in the opening game before making it competitive in the final two games. Senior Jill Gassen led the way with eight kills and finished her career with a Washburn records of 1732 kills and 181 solo blocks. She also finished second in Washburn history with 549 total blocks. For the season Gassen broke her career best mark with 461, which was also the fifth highest total in team history. Washburn finished the season 12-22 and in seventh in the MIAA with a 5-11 mark.
